Jayson Tatum scores 51 points in Celtics rout over Wizards

For the fifth time in his NBA career, Jayson Tatum of the Boston Celtics reached the half-century mark in total points in in one game, On Sunday, Tatum scored 51  points as the Celtics defeated the Washington Wizards 116-87.

The most points Tatum has had in one game was 60. That came in a 143-140 Celtics overtime win over the San Antonio Spurs on April 30, 2021. Tatum also had 53 points in a 145-136 overtime win over the Minnesota Timberwolves on April 9, 2021, 50 points in a 118-100 Celtics win over the Wizards in the 2021 NBA Eastern Conference Play-in game, and 50 points in a 125-119 Celtics win over the Brooklyn Nets in game three of the Eastern Conference quarterfinals.

In the Celtics win over the Spurs last season, Tatum tied a Celtics record with Larry Bird for most points in one game by a Celtics player. In the Celtics win over the Timberwolves, Tatum became the youngest Celtics player to record 50 points in one game at 23 years and 37 days old.

In Sunday’s win, Tatum made 18 of 28 field goals, nine of 14 three-point attempts, and all six free throw attempts. He also had 10 rebounds, seven assists and was a +31. Tatum becomes the second Celtics player to get 50 points in a game this season. The other was Jaylen Brown, who had 50 points in a 116-111 Celtics overtime win over the Orlando Magic on January 2. The other players to reach the 50-point plateau in 2021-22 are Trae Young of the Atlanta Hawks, Kevin Durant of the Brooklyn Nets, Stephen Curry of the Golden State Warriors, and Joel Embiid of the Philadelphia 76ers.
